Section 1: Finding Musicians In ‘Real Life’

  1. Put up an ad or notice at your local music store. It works.
  2. Check your local rehearsal rooms.
  3. Take group music lessons.
  4. Go to open mic nights and jam sessions.
  5. Ask your guitar or music teacher.
  6. Get your oldest friends together.

How do I find people to join a singing group?

Ask around your community. If you know people who are already in bands or singing groups, ask them if they know anyone who is currently looking to join a group. Post about it on social media. Ask your old band or music teacher if they know anyone interested.

Can you start an all-girl band?

Starting an all-girl band can be more than just a dream. Girl bands are bands consisting of all female members, slightly differing from girl groups with the defining quality of its members not strictly being vocalists. Members of girl bands sing songs, play guitar, play drums, and play bass.

How do you pick a girl band?

Agree on the band’s style. Appearance is also an important part of the girl band package. Create a visual match that is complementary to the sound of the band. You and the other ladies don’t have to wear the exact same thing, but dressing in a similar style might take less focus away from the band itself.

How do you get people to audition for your band?

Take out an ad in the newspaper. That can help interested musicians and singers find you. Talk to people at your church or community center. They can help you spread the word about your group and the audition. Try announcing the event on social media like Facebook and Twitter.
